Gingersnaps vs. French bread — In-Depth Nutrition Comparison

Compare

Important differences between gingersnaps and french bread

  • Gingersnaps have more manganese, iron, and copper; however, french bread is richer in selenium, vitamin B1, vitamin B3, folate, and phosphorus.
  • French bread's daily need coverage for selenium is 45% more.
  • Gingersnaps contain 5 times more saturated fat than french bread. Gingersnaps contain 2.451g of saturated fat, while french bread contains 0.502g.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Cookies, gingersnaps and Bread, french or vienna, toasted (includes sourdough).
